Recognized as one of Malaysia’s “40 Under 40” Emerging Architects, Ar. Tan Kwon Chong (Rien) is a rising force in architecture, known for his bold approach to design and leadership within the profession. He is the founder of Arplus Training Plt and Managing Director of TKCA Architects Sdn Bhd, a practice driven by the philosophy “Inspired to Inspire.”
Rien holds a First Class Honours degree in Architecture from UCSI University and a Master of Architecture from Universiti Teknologi Malaysia. His early career experiences in Osaka, Taipei, and New York broadened his perspective and shaped his commitment to sustainable, human- centered, and future-ready design.
His career gained momentum in 2016 when he won the Asia Young Designer Award (AYDA), and in 2019, he won the International Design Competition on Tropical Housing for the Orang Asli, sparking collaborations with developers and NGOs to uplift underserved communities through design innovation.
Under Rien’s leadership, TKCA Architects became the first Malaysian practice to win the UIA 2030 Award for the groundbreaking SkyBlox Co-Living Housing project, celebrated at the World Urban Forum 2024 in Cairo. His works — including Spectrum House, Sama Square, and Ashwood Condominium— have represented Malaysia on international stages across Hong Kong, India, Seoul, and Taiwan, earning accolades such as the Seoul Design Award, Taiwan Design Awards, Golden Pin Design Award, Creative Colour Awards, Design for Asia Award, PAM Awards, Sustainability Awards, MIID Reka Awards, National Energy Awards, and Malaysian Construction Industry Excellence Awards.
Beyond practice, Rien plays an active role in shaping Malaysia’s architectural landscape. Since 2021, he has chaired key committees within the Malaysian Institute of Architects (PAM), including Professional Practice, Promotion of Profession, ESG, Housing & Urban Wellbeing, and CPD. In 2023, he represented Malaysia as a YSEALI Professional Fellow with the U.S. Green Building Council in Washington, D.C., and was named an Augustman of the Year for his impact on Malaysia’s Art & Design scene. Most recently, he was appointed Festival Director of the Kuala Lumpur Architecture Festival (KLAF) 2026, solidifying his influence as a thought leader for the next generation of architects.
A strong advocate of purpose-driven design, Rien continues to champion architecture that inspires, empowers, and creates lasting change — establishing himself as one of Malaysia’s most exciting rising architects.
